roasted potato-wrapped haddock by bob w..

This is a very easy recipe for fish. I have used other white fish with this and it works well.

prep time 25 Min
cook time 20 Min
method Bake
yield 4 serving(s)

Ingredients

  • 1 1/2 pounds haddock, or other white fish.,two large fillets.
  • 1 tablespoon canola oil
  • 2 medium youkon gold potatos
  • 1 tablespoon dijon mustard
  • 1 tablespoon mayonnaise, light
  • 1 teaspoon garlic, minced
  • 1 teaspoon onion, diced small
  • 2 tablespoons dried thyme, divied.
  • - salt and pepper, totaste.

How To Make roasted potato-wrapped haddock by bob w..

  • Step 1
    You will need a 10 or 12 inch cast iron skillet. Pre-heat oven to 400 degrees. Add oil to skillet and set in heated oven to heat.
  • Step 2
    In a mixing bowl add mustard, mayonnaise, garlic, onion, and 1/2 teaspoon dried thyme. Mix together well. Using a mandolin set to the thinnest setting. Slice potatoes and set a side.
  • Step 3
    Remove skillet from oven. ( Be care full it will be hot). Carefully put a layer of potatoes overlapping on the bottom of the skillet. Season potatoes with a little salt and pepper And thyme
  • Step 4
    Pat the fish dry. Brush mustard-mayonnaise mix over both sides of fillets. Lay fish over potatoes. Place a second layer of potatoes over the top of the fish. Season with salt, pepper, and thyme. Spray top of potatoes with cooking spray..
  • Step 5
    Place skillet in oven and bake for 14-16 minutes. after 16 minutes. Remove skillet, set oven to broil. Replace skillet and broil for 3-4 minutes or until potatoes are brown.
  • Step 6
    Remove skillet from oven and set on pot holders. Carefully divide into 4 pieces and set on plates. Enjoy.
